Output 6518202250f64ba81a227a4c7295d5fe58eec347701ba73f0a61ba019b219b8b:0

value
1382677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96cb6967360a9420a836e147bf953900def88cbe OP_EQUAL
address
3FSLxcWxEStoaYpKFja51TGSXAewhDvaEx
transaction
6518202250f64ba81a227a4c7295d5fe58eec347701ba73f0a61ba019b219b8b
spent
true